Why Long-Term Alcohol and Drug Rehab Works in Hamlet, Indiana

NIDA, or the National Institute on Drug Abuse reports that long term alcohol and drug rehab in Hamlet is among the most effective types of drug and alcohol addiction treatment. This is due to the fact that statistics show that these facilities often boast higher success rates and can result in better results in the long run.

Whereas short-term residential programs will only require you to participate in treatment for a couple of weeks, long term drug and alcohol treatment may last for many months and sometimes up to a year or longer.

In certain ways, therefore, long term rehabilitation works as a type of halfway house that allows the most vulnerable addicted individuals a time period of intensive care. While there, therefore, you will be in an environment overseen closely by physicians and other health care professionals for a long time. Meaning, that you may experience a higher potential for recovery.

That said, long term drug and alcohol addiction treatment facilities in Hamlet, IN. vary considerably. Whereas some of these programs will provide you with 8 hours of counseling per week and allow you to spend 7 hours per day on predetermined activities, others will provide more activities.

However, most long-term treatment centers will insist you to abide by a set of ethos, norms, and regulations - failure to comply may be cause for you to be formally expelled from the program. Still, others are not as rigid and could even permit you to spend some of the nights with friends and loved ones, or to work outside the facility here and there.

Overall, however, Hamlet, Indiana long term drug rehab is among the most workable of all forms of rehabilitation. This is due to the fact that drug addiction is such a chronic and cyclic disorder that demands long term care and oversight - which should persist on even after you check out of the treatment facility. Long-term rehabilitation could also lower your risk of relapse in addition to teaching you how to function and operate ordinarily by living a sober lifestyle.
